Short of a long story - able to hook up with a renowned NSWO expert a couple of hours away and fortunate that he led me and a couple other photographers to two NSWOS who were very accommodating to our photography shenanigans.

Incredible experience and majestic, tiny raptors for sure! The NSWO in the last three shots has a vole in its grasp. Tried to better showcase it - but limited in maneuver space and did not want to spook the little guy.

Tech notes - this was a spur-of the moment adventure and did not have time to go home and grab my 70-200...which would have been perfect...so made due with the incredibly sharp Nikkor 24-120/4 S lens.
